VAMP

VAMP, a tetrapeptide, is a competitive dipeptidyl peptidase IV (DPP-IV) inhibitor with an IC50 of 1.00 μM and a Kd of 6.89 μM. VAMP effectively targets the DPP-IV-GLP-1 axis and can be used for the study of type 2 diabetes[1].
